Description Mark Wagner 2006-09-07 20:11:32 UTC
When emerging sys-apps/hal-0.5.7-r3, the install fails during the ">>> Merging sys-apps/hal-0.5.7-r3 to /" step.


The tail end of the emerge output:

>>> /etc/init.d/hald
--- /etc/dev.d/
--- /etc/dev.d/default/
>>> /etc/dev.d/default/hal-unmount.dev
--- /lib/
--- /lib/udev/
>>> /lib/udev/hal_unmount
--- /media/
!!! Failed to chown/chmod/unlink in movefile()
!!! /media/.keep
!!! [Errno 1] Operation not permitted: '/media/.keep'

I suspect this is because I've already got a hard drive mounted at /media
Comment 1 Jakub Moc (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2006-09-08 01:01:37 UTC
So unmount it and try again?
Comment 2 Mark Wagner 2006-09-08 18:01:07 UTC
(In reply to comment #1)
> So unmount it and try again?
> 

Yep, that fixed the problem.  Now all I have to do is figure out where to put my MP3 and movie collection now that /media is unavailable.
